Is Warr Acres, OK Safe?

The F grade indicates that the rate of crime is much higher than that of the average US city. Warr Acres ranks in the 5th percentile for safety, meaning it is safer than 5% of cities but less safe than 95%. This analysis applies only to Warr Acres's official city boundaries. See the table below for nearby cities.

The crime rate in Warr Acres is 61.50 per 1,000 residents in the typical year. Warr Acres Residents generally consider the northeast part of the city to be the safest. Your chance of being a victim of crime in Warr Acres varies by neighborhood - ranging from 1 in 10 in the southeast neighborhoods to 1 in 23 in the northeast.

When looking at total crime counts (rather than per capita rates), the southeast parts of Warr Acres, OK see the most incidents - about 107 per year. In contrast, the northeast part of the city has the fewest, with approximately 36 crimes annually.

The Cost of Crime™ in Warr Acres, OK

The total projected cost of crime in Warr Acres for 2025 is $9,771,765. This translates to approximately $883 per resident and $2,328 per household. On average, crime-related costs account for 3.0% of the median household income in Warr Acres. These figures reflect only tangible costs, which include the following:
  1. Criminal justice system costs (law enforcement, courts, and imprisonment): 54.0%
  2. Direct costs to victims (damaged property, medical expenses, and lost wages): 35.1%
  3. Lost economic contribution from offenders (time in prison or repeat offenses): 10.9%

The Intangible Cost of Crime in Warr Acres, OK

CrimeGrade primarily focuses on tangible costs, but the true impact of crime extends beyond economic. Pain and suffering for victims and their families are difficult to quantify, but research-based methodologies help estimate these effects. Using these methodologies, we calculate that the intangible cost of crime in Warr Acres totals $18,371,040 ($1,660 per resident). When added to the tangible costs, this brings the total estimated cost of crime to $28,142,805 ($2,543 per resident). Interpreting the Crime Maps

When interpreting the Warr Acres crime map, keep in mind that crime rates are measured per resident. Areas with high visitor traffic, such as shopping districts, may appear to have higher crime rates simply because more crimes occur where people gather - even if few residents live there. For example, the south part of the city has more retail establishments, which can artificially inflate crime rates in that area. Red areas on the map do not necessarily mean a neighborhood is unsafe for residents.

More issues arise with places like airports, parks, and schools. Major airports always look like high-crime locations due to the large number of people and the low population nearby. Parks and designated recreational areas, of which Warr Acres has 1, have the same problem. Of Warr Acres’s 11,066 residents, few live near recreational areas. Because many people visit, crime rates may appear higher even for safe parks. Crime occurs where people gather, whether they live there or not. Before assuming an area is unsafe, consider both per-capita crime rates and total crime counts, as well as the types of destinations nearby.
